In my grilling area, I ordered 3 stainless steel food service carts with locking wheels from Amazon. You can order as many as you think you need and configure them in an arrangement that works for you and your space. They're inexpensive, portable, and easy to clean. I have a 270 GS smoker/grill sitting on the shorter table. I use the two taller tables for prep, cooked food staging, etc.

I also ordered 2, 32 gallon trash cans on wheels from Lowe's where I keep charcoal, charcoal chimney, wood chunks, bbq tools, a small stainless steel shop vac, lighters, etc.


Additionally, I have a Step-On trash can from Lowe's that I keep a liner in to dump ashes, used aluminum foil, and anything else I don't want to throw away in the house.
